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. UCLA, Takeda to study how disruption of circadian rhythms promotes type 2 diabetes

Millions of individuals worldwide are exposed to shift work and numerous environmental conditions that disturb circadian clock function and disrupt normal circadian rhythms. Environmental conditions associated with disrupted circadian rhythms greatly increase the risk for development of type 2 diabetes and metabolic syndrome and also hinder the treatment and management of hyperglycemia in existing patients with diabetes.

Analysis reveals decreasing trend in infection-related mortality among kidney transplant recipients

Since the 1990s, the risk of dying from infections after kidney transplantation has dropped by half, according to a recent analysis. The analysis, which appears in an upcoming issue of the Clinical Journal of the American Society of Nephrology, also found that common bacterial infections remain the most frequent cause of infection-related death among transplant recipients.

Less-invasive surgery for lung cancer reduces risk of post-operative bleeding, complications

In a large international clinical study presented at the 99th Annual Meeting of the American Association for Thoracic Surgery, Dr. Moishe Liberman, a thoracic surgeon and researcher at the University of Montreal Hospital Research Center, and his team showed that thoracoscopic lobectomy—video-assisted thoracoscopic surgery—combined with pulmonary artery sealing using an ultrasonic energy device reduced the risk of post-operative bleeding, complications and pain.
